§ 17-7203 — Formation of close corporation
A close corporation shall be formed in accordance with K.S.A. 17-6001 and 17-6002 and K.S.A. 17-7908 through 17-7910, and amendments thereto, except that:
(a)Its articles of incorporation shall contain a heading stating the name of the corporation and that it is a close corporation; and
(b)its articles of incorporation shall contain the provisions required by K.S.A. 17-7202, and amendments thereto.
